Analyst Upgrades and Downgrades
A number of equities analysts have issued reports on the company. Bank of America cut their target price on Franco-Nevada from C$272.00 to C$266.00 in a research report on Wednesday, May 28th. National Bankshares cut their target price on Franco-Nevada from C$220.00 to C$215.00 in a research report on Tuesday, March 11th. BMO Capital Markets boosted their price target on Franco-Nevada from C$260.00 to C$261.00 in a report on Wednesday, May 28th. TD Securities downgraded Franco-Nevada from a "buy" rating to a "hold" rating and set a C$152.00 price target for the company. in a report on Tuesday, March 11th. Finally, CIBC boosted their price target on Franco-Nevada from C$260.00 to C$280.00 in a report on Thursday, April 17th.

Franco-Nevada Company Profile
(Get Free Report)Franco-Nevada Corporation operates as a gold-focused royalty and streaming company in South America, Central America, Mexico, the United States, Canada, and internationally. It operates through Mining and Energy segments. The company manages its portfolio with a focus on precious metals, such as gold, silver, and platinum group metals; and engages in the sale of crude oil, natural gas, and natural gas liquids through a third-party marketing agent.
